Divide ₹360 between two children in the ratio 4 : 5. The smaller share is:
  • (A) ₹140
  • (B) ₹160
  • (C) ₹180
  • (D) ₹200

Correct Answer: B
Explanation:

Smaller share = 360 × 4/9 = ₹160.

A total of 96 marbles are shared in the ratio 5 : 3. The first share is:
  • (A) 36
  • (B) 48
  • (C) 60
  • (D) 72

Correct Answer: C
Explanation:

First share = 96 × 5/8 = 60.

A bag contains red and blue balls in the ratio 2 : 5. If there are 14 red balls, the number of blue balls is:
  • (A) 21
  • (B) 28
  • (C) 35
  • (D) 42

Correct Answer: C
Explanation:

Scale factor = 14/2 = 7. Blue balls = 5 × 7 = 35.

Divide 84 kg of rice in the ratio 2 : 5. The smaller share is:
  • (A) 20 kg
  • (B) 24 kg
  • (C) 28 kg
  • (D) 30 kg

Correct Answer: B
Explanation:

Smaller share = 84 × 2/7 = 24 kg.

₹700 is shared among two brothers in the ratio 3 : 4. The elder brother gets:
  • (A) ₹300
  • (B) ₹350
  • (C) ₹400
  • (D) ₹450

Correct Answer: C
Explanation:

Elder brother's share = 700 × 4/7 = ₹400.

A total of 144 chocolates are distributed in the ratio 5 : 4. The larger share is:
  • (A) 64
  • (B) 72
  • (C) 80
  • (D) 90

Correct Answer: C
Explanation:

Larger share = 144 × 5/9 = 80.

Divide 180 m into the ratio 2 : 7. The smaller part is:
  • (A) 30 m
  • (B) 40 m
  • (C) 50 m
  • (D) 60 m

Correct Answer: B
Explanation:

Smaller part = 180 × 2/9 = 40 m.

₹540 is divided among three friends in the ratio 2 : 3 : 4. The largest share is:
  • (A) ₹120
  • (B) ₹160
  • (C) ₹180
  • (D) ₹240

Correct Answer: D
Explanation:

Total parts = 9. Largest share = 540 × 4/9 = ₹240.

Divide 99 pens in the ratio 4 : 5. The smaller share is:
  • (A) 40
  • (B) 44
  • (C) 45
  • (D) 55

Correct Answer: B
Explanation:

Smaller share = 99 × 4/9 = 44.
